How they compare
Kenya currently reports 0.204 TJ against 0.1 TJ in Polynesia, a difference of 0.104 TJ.
That makes Kenya's figure about 2.0 times Polynesia's.
Across all 10 years both countries report, Kenya has been ahead every year.
Kenya ranks 81st and Polynesia ranks 82nd of 84 countries.
Kenya has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.

About this data
The FAOSTAT domain Bioenergy contains data on bioenergy use and bioenergy production, covering the following items: i) animal waste, ii) bagasse, iii) bio jet kerosene, iv) biodiesel, v) biogases, vi) biogasoline, vii) black liquor, viii) charcoal, ix) fuelwood, x) other liquid biofuels, xi) other vegetal material and residues.
